Tour Attraction in Coxes Bazer






Tourist attractions near the town

Shemon Local hotels arrange beachside accessories for the tourists at Cox's Bazar
The beach is the main attraction of the town. Larger hotels provide exclusive beachside areas with accessories for the hotel guests. Visitors in other hotels visit the Laboni beach, which is the area of the beach closest to the town. In addition to the beach, there are several places of interest near the town, which can easily be visited from the town center.
  • Aggmeda Khyang: a large temple, and a place revered by around 400,000 Buddhist people of Cox's Bazar; The main sanctuary is posted on a series of round timber columns. It has a prayer chamber and an assembly hall along with a repository of large and small bronze Buddha images and a number of old manuscripts.
v     Near about 10 kilometres from Cox's Bazar, Ramu   is a village with a sizeable Buddhist population. The village is famous for its home made cigars . There are monasteries, khyangs, and pagoda containing images of Buddha in metal gold, and other metals with precious stones. The temple on the bank of the Baghkhali
v     River houses not only relics and Burmese handicrafts but also a large bronze statue of Buddha measuring thirteen feet in height which rests on a six-foot-high pedestal. Weavers ply their trade in open workshops and craftsmen make handmade cigars in their pagoda-like houses.
v     Dilhamra Safari Park: Bangabandhu Sheikh MujibSafari Park is the first Safari Park in Bangladesh. The nature of the forest is rich with Garjan, Boilam, Telsur, and Chapalish along with herbs, shrubs, and creepers. Safari Park is a declared protected area where the animals are kept in fairly large areas with natural environments and visitors can see the animals by bus or jeep or on foot. This park was established on the basis of the South Asian model. This safari park is an extension of an animal sanctuary located along the Chittagong-Cox's Bazar road about 50 kilometres (31 mi) from Cox's Bazar town.
